Wembley Prepares for Lana Del Rey’s Two-Night Takeover with Special Guest Addison Rae

Lana Del Rey is returning to London in style, with not just one, but two major performances at Wembley Stadium. The iconic singer-songwriter will headline the venue on Thursday, July 3, and Friday, July 4, marking one of her most anticipated UK appearances this year.

The concerts come after a string of high-profile collaborations and successful tour dates across Europe and North America. Lana’s signature blend of nostalgic Americana and moody pop has drawn massive audiences—and her Wembley show is expected to sell out both nights.

Addison Rae, rising pop star and internet personality, will serve as the opening act. Based on prior events, Rae is expected to hit the stage at 7:30 PM, while Del Rey will likely begin her set around 9:00 PM.

The Wembley performances are expected to conclude by 10:30 PM, aligning with Lana’s usual concert timing.

This marks a significant moment in her tour calendar, not just due to the scale of the venue, but also because of her rising popularity across multiple generations of fans. Her atmospheric stage design and poetic lyricism make every show a fully immersive experience.

Attendees are advised to arrive early due to heightened security protocols and potential delays. While official venue timings haven’t been posted, reports suggest entry will begin as early as 4:30 PM.
